The Poetical and Dramatic Works of Oliver Goldsmith Now First Collected: With an Account of the Life and Writings of the Author is a book written by Oliver Goldsmith in 1780. It is a collection of the poet and playwright's works, including his most famous plays, The Good-Natured Man and She Stoops to Conquer, as well as his poetry and other dramatic works. The book also includes an account of Goldsmith's life and writings, providing readers with insight into the author's personal and professional life.
